ionic bonds
if the difference in electronegativites is 1.7 or greater the bond is considered to be ionic
covalent bond
covalent bonds are formed by sharing electrons between atoms.
1. polar covalent: electronegativites difference of 0.3 to 1.7
non-polar covalent
electronegativites difference below .3
diatomic element
an element that is found in nature with 2 atoms bonded together. there are seven
the 7 diatomic elements
hydrogen, nitrogen, oxygen, fluorine, chlorine, bromine, iodine

(i bring clay for your new house)
